What to Ask Before Hiring an Appliance Repair Technician

It’s one of those things homeowners dread and it never happens at a convenient time – an appliance breakdown. Not only does a breakdown disrupt your entire household routine but now you have to find an experienced and reliable appliance repair technician. Simply getting online, typing in “appliance repair near me” and scheduling an appointment with the first company that appears on the screen isn’t the best solution. While it may be convenient, this may not provide you with the top-quality service you want. Here are some things you should find out before choosing an appliance repair service.

Is the Service Center Certified?

Why is this important? An approved Certified Service Center undergoes an extensive review of their management as well as their qualifications, customer service policies and even their dress code. This ensures that you will receive the highest-quality product and customer service possible. Certified Service Centers are among the best in the country and have preferred status with both manufacturers and customers.

Are the Appliance Repair Technicians Certified?

Proper and continuous training on all major manufacturer’s products is key for providing top-quality repair services. Be sure to ask the repair center if they employ PSA Industry-Certified and Master Technicians. These repair technicians receive up-to-date training from the manufacturers themselves and have instant access to their service support lines and manuals. Enlisting the services of certified technicians will ensure that your repair is completed properly and your warranty is preserved.

Are Background Checks and Drug Tests Conducted?

Did you know that recent studies estimate that 11% of service technicians have background discrepancies the could potentially create customer risk? When you hire an appliance repair technician, you are essentially inviting a stranger into your home. Knowing that the service center you are dealing with performs background checks and drug testing will provide you with a comfortable, safe and secure customer experience while your repair is being completed.

Is Emergency Service Available?

When a major household appliance breaks down, it is often an emergency. If the service center you call doesn’t offer emergency service, you could be waiting days or even weeks for service. Ask yourself, can you go that long without appliances like your washer or refrigerator? The faster the repair is completed, the sooner you can get your household routine back to normal.

Are Two-Hour Arrival Windows Provided?

Almost everyone has experienced the frustration of spending a whole day waiting for an appliance repair technician to show up. Not only is it aggravating but it can also be costly if you have to take the whole day off from work. You want to deal with an appliance repair center that values your time as much as you do. Providing a two-hour window of arrival will save you time, money and frustration.

Are OEM or Aftermarket Parts Used?

You may be thinking that as long as the parts used to get your appliance up and running, it doesn’t matter if they are OEM (original equipment manufacturer) or aftermarket parts. Aftermarket parts are typically less expensive and may reduce the cost of the repair. However, not using OEM parts can have a negative impact on the appliance’s integrity and durability. More importantly, should your repair be made with aftermarket parts, it could void your warranty. 

What if the Appliance Can’t be Repaired?

If after examining your appliance, the repair technician determines it is unrepairable, you are now faced with having to shop around to replace it. It’s always better to deal with a service center that’s affiliated with a reputable appliance retailer. Then the service technician will be able to work with you and one of their knowledgeable sales staff to offer you a selection of comparable models to choose from and have them delivered in a timely manner. This will save you time, minimize your inconvenience and provide you with the perfect replacement appliance.

Clean Your Oven Early Every year, just days before Thanksgiving, we see a spike in service calls. Many are the result of damage caused by the oven’s self-cleaning feature. If you are going to use this feature, do it well before starting your holiday cooking. The self-cleaning feature, due to the high level of heat it produces can sometimes burn out the heating element. Control panels can also burn out or fuses can blow out. These issues will require you to repair or even replace your oven - an inconvenience and extra expense you don’t need right before the holidays. Our appliance repair experts recommend self-cleaning your oven two to three weeks before Thanksgiving. This will leave time for repairs to be made without interfering with your holiday dinner. If you wait too long, skip the self-cleaning feature and just carefully remove any burnt food residue and wipe down the oven walls. Once the holiday has passed, then you can safely use the self-cleaning function. Use the Oven’s Convection Setting We understand not every oven has one, but if your oven has a convection setting, don’t be afraid to use it. Convection heat makes food cook faster, more evenly, and provides better browning. The convection feature is perfect for roasting a turkey or baking cookies. The convention feature typically does it in less time or at lower temperatures. The general rule of thumb for convection cooking is to set the oven temperature 25 degrees lower for baking and subtract 25% from the cooking time for roasting. If you’ve never used your convection setting before, we recommend that you refer to the manufacturer's manual for specific temperature settings and cooking times. Also, be sure to do a test run before getting ready to start the holiday cooking. Clean Out and Organize Your Refrigerator When you’re preparing your kitchen for the holidays, it the perfect time to clean out the refrigerator. Get rid of any expired or forgotten foods. With all that holiday cooking, your going to need the space and it’s best not to overload the refrigerator. If the refrigerator is too full, it’s airflow will be limited. This could lead to it working harder to maintain the proper temperature, causing unnecessary wear and tear. Overloading the refrigerator also increases the possibility of the refrigerator not closing completely which could lead to food spoilage as well as increased wear and tear. Don’t Forget the Dishwasher After all that cooking and baking, there is going to be a lot of cleaning to be done. Your dishwasher is the star of kitchen clean up, so it’s essential to use and maintain it properly. It’s important to scrape off excess food to keep the jets and drains from becoming clogged. Clogging could lead to improper cleaning or, worse yet, a flood on the kitchen floor. However, don’t over-rinse the dishes before loading them into the dishwasher. The enzymes in today’s dishwasher detergents require some food residue in order to activate. Our appliance repair experts recommend running hot water in the sink closest to the dishwasher before starting it. This will ensure your dishwasher’s water is hot at the very beginning of the first cycle. Also, use the right amount of soap, as excess suds can bog down the machine. If you’re not using a premeasured packet or tablet, follow the manufacturer's instructions. Make Plenty of Ice With all the holiday entertaining, you’ll probably use a lot more ice than normal. Before the festivities begin, it’s a good idea to get rid of all the ice in your freezer and start fresh. If the ice has been sitting in your freezer for a while, it can take on the odors or tastes from the food you’ve stored there. That’s not exactly what you want to add to your guest’s drinks. Completely empty out your ice compartment and let it refill with fresh ice. Put the freshly frozen ice into sealed plastic bags and store it on the freezer shelf. Repeat this process a couple of times. This will not only protect the ice from picking up any odors or tastes from the freezer but it will also ensure that you won’t run out of ice.
